登录
注册
回到首页
AI
搜索
发现报告
发现数据
发现专题
研选报告
定制报告
VIP
权益
发现大使
发现一下
行业研究
公司研究
宏观策略
财报
招股书
会议纪要
海南封关
低空经济
DeepSeek
AIGC
大模型
当前位置:首页
/
行业研究
/
报告详情
Nebula Graph v3 ——开源分布式高性能图数据库 - 吴敏
信息技术
2022-03-21
DataFunSummit 2022 :第二届知识图谱在线峰会PPT汇总
心***
AI智能总结
查看更多
Nebula Graph v3.0系统架构演进总结
1. Nebula Graph v3.0概况
版本时间线
:Nebula Graph v1.0 Core (2019), v2.0 Core (2021), v3.0 GDBMS (2022)
版本兼容性
:X.Y.Z格式,X版本不兼容数据格式,Y版本功能增加可能不兼容API
社区版与企业版
:社区版每年4个Y版本,企业版LTS 3年,每年2个Y版本
核心数据
:2k+开发者,40%+MAU,300+企业用户,20+千亿点边规模
下载渠道
:GitHub、Docker Hub、官网
社区活跃度
:GitHub 120万PV,4k+Topic,1k论坛用户,2k微信群活跃成员
2. Nebula Graph产品特性
架构特性
:计算存储分离,分布式架构,高可用性,多图空间
数据特性
:属性图,强一致性(CP),多平台运行(X86/ARM)
计算特性
:原生声明式语言nGQL兼容openCypher,多种计算框架与算法
主要组件
:Meta Engine (数据管理),Storage Engine (数据存储),Graph Engine (计算查询)
3. 核心组件详解
Meta Engine
:分布式用户管理、Partition管理、Schema管理、数据生命周期管理
Storage Engine
:分布式存储,支持混合读写、只读、目标规模扩展,V3.0新增无Tag点、细粒度算子、更多下推规则
Graph Engine
:大并发吞吐与低时延,V3.0新增统一算子、更多RBO规则、openCypher兼容、LDBC-SNB支持
4. 图计算与图分析
图计算能力
:19种算法,支持Plato、GraphX、Euler等框架
图分析特性
:深度图结构分析加速,减少序列化RPC,加入更多统计值
5. 数据导入与可视化
数据导入方式
:CSV、JSON、MySQL、Neo4j等多种数据源
可视化工具
:Nebula Studio (DBA与开发人员),Nebula Explorer (图语言操作),Nebula Dashboard (集群管理)
6. 性能表现
性能趋势
:2.0->2.5->2.6逐步提升,2.6->3.0基本持平,惯例GA+1版本调优
7. 演进与尝试
图语言演进
:1.0 (基础功能),2.0 (引入openCypher),3.0 (完善语法与性能)
图结构与图属性
:基于分布式KV建模,图结构邻接表(LSM-tree),V3.0实现图结构与属性分离
社区与版本迭代
:需求来源社区与商业用户,迭代节奏可预期,透明路线图
8. 展望4.0
ISO-GQL
:重新设计KV格式、Query Engine、Meta Engine、通信协议,适配SDK/Tools
图计算与图分析
:集成测试框架,NGTP脚本集成,日常CI与专项压测
Nebula Cloud Native
:重新设计计算存储架构,支持全托管与半托管模式
9. 商业合作与社区活动
商业合作伙伴
:同路人计划,OEM/Reseller/Agent模式,免费企业版,5*8技术支持
社区活动
:大版本捉虫、Nebula Meetup、Nebula Hackathon、Nebula UCNebula用户大会
海外市场
:GitHub、Twitter社区,discuss.nebula-graph.com.cn论坛
你可能感兴趣
金融级分布式高性能图数据库的构建 - 沈游人@海致
金融
DataFunSummit 2022 :第二届知识图谱在线峰会PPT汇总
2022-03-21
5-5 快手分布式高性能图平台 KGraph 及其应用
电子设备
DataFunSummit2022:图机器学习峰会
2022-07-18
高性能图数据库金融应用白皮书
金融
北京前沿金融监管科技研究院
2024-02-15
Graph A1:大模型浪潮下的图计算
信息技术
全国智能计算标准化工作组
2024-11-07
吴晟 SkyWalking 原生数据库发布与云原生下复杂部署关系的识别
信息技术
2024 第23届 GOPS 全球运维大会暨 XOps 技术创新峰会 · 北京站
2024-07-17